Ordinals
beta
Sat 682397281074991
decimal
23093.368481074991
percentile
1.364794562149982%
name
mkiftwhhxefa
cycle
0
epoch
2
block
23093
offset
368481074991
timestamp
2023-12-26 08:23:48 UTC
rarity
common
prev
next